The investigation on the fire where I live saw the sight under armed guard for 3 weeks.
They lay out a grid using string and stakes. It is meticulous, tedious work. They photograph every grid. Sometimes it’s over several acres.
The investigators don’t need every idiot and his brother flying a drone over them to satisfy their morbid curiosity.
Flying a drone over an active fire will land you in federal court and rightfully so. If a drone is spotted, they halt air ops until the drone is removed.
